Coca-Cola Zero Sugar is the next step in our strategy to help people reduce their sugar intake. It's the result of years of innovation and recipe development and will replace Coca-Cola Zero, which was launched in 2006.
As well as the improved taste, Coca-Cola Zero Sugar has a new name and new look, to make it even clearer that the drink is sugar-free.
The new packaging design will be in line with the company’s ‘One Brand’ marketing strategy, and feature the Coca-Cola red disc to encourage people who love the taste of the 130-year-old original to give the zero sugar version a try.
The launch will be supported by a £10 million marketing campaign designed to get people to choose no sugar, which is our biggest investment in a new product launch for a decade.
Today’s announcement is the latest in a series of actions from Coca-Cola Great Britain and is part of a £30 million investment in developing and improving the drinks offered to promote moderation and choice, and help people reduce their sugar and calorie intake.
These actions include changing recipes, introducing smaller portion sizes and investing more money in marketing our no sugar drink options.
